1:3-3.1. Numbering of laws; first and second annual session

Every bill and joint resolution enacted into law during the first annual session of a Legislature shall be numbered and printed as a public law of that legislative year. Every bill and joint resolution introduced in the first annual session of a Legislature and enacted into law after the convening of the second annual session of the same Legislature shall be numbered and printed as a public law of the legislative year of the second annual session.
L.1970, c. 1, s. 1, eff. Jan. 26, 1970.
